Cibelle

The Shine of Dried Electric Leaves

2006-05-08

“see-BELL-ee” Cibelle makes use of a variety of elements to create a unique sound. Imagine a collaboration among Tom Waits, Madeline Peyroux, Bebel Gilberto and Architecture in Helsinki and you’re halfway there. The album is packed with acoustic instrumentation, shaped by electronic processing, with creative use of miscellaneous items like kids toys peppered throughout. -Pete
